Text
(a)A person acquires a security or an interest therein, under this chapter, if:
(1)the person is a purchaser to whom a security is delivered pursuant to § 47-8-301 ; or (2) the person acquires a security entitlement to the security pursuant to § 47-8-501 .
(b)A person acquires a financial asset, other than a security, or an interest therein, under this chapter, if the person acquires a security entitlement to the financial asset.
(c)A person who acquires a security entitlement to a security or other financial asset has the rights specified in part 5, but is a purchaser of any security, security entitlement, or other financial asset held by the securities intermediary only to the extent provided in § 47-8-503 .
